I've done 2 contests now through 99Designs and enjoyed the process both times. The first time I had to reach out to support for an issue and they responded within 12hrs and were very helpful and easy to deal with. I was very happy with the winning logo. The second contest overall went well and I'm very happy with the designer I chose and the work they did. I was however slightly disappointed that the 299 silver package promised 30 designs and I only received 3 (with 2 being entry-level designers and 1 mid-level). It all worked out and I'm completely satisfied, but it's worth noting because I felt like I was paying for more choices and more brilliance to compete for the win.

I use Sage 300 and have for about 7 years now. Sage is both easy and difficult, depending on what you need and who you are dealing with. Technical support is, in my opinion, top notch. Most of my support comes from my wonderful reseller, Kerr. But the part that comes straight from Sage is always on point. The downside tends to come from my AP dept when they deal with invoices. It has improved over the years, but was a challenge in the beginning. I still at times find myself confused by invoicing that should be the same year over year.
